DIFFERENTIAL

Differential
The differential is a very important part
in a vehicle, as a component transfer, the
engine power is transmitted to the
wheels. Engine power is transferred by a
rear propeller shaft to the wheel first
changed direction by differential
rotation are then referred to rear axle
shafts after that to the rear wheels.

FUNCTIONS OF A GENERATOR
1. Further reduces the rotations coming from the gear box before the same are passed on to the
rear axles.

2. Changes the direction of axis of rotation of the power by 90o i.e. from being longitudinal to
transverse direction.

3. To distribute power equally to both the rear driving axles when the tractor is moving in straight
ahead direction.

4. To distribute the power as per requirement to the driving axles during turning i.e. more rotations
are required by the outer wheel as compared to the inner wheel – during turns.

What are the common types of
Differential?
 Open differential – As one of the more common types of differentials which is found in most family
sedans and economy cars, the open differential splits the engine torque in two and allows the wheels to
rotate at different speeds. 
 Locking differential – Also known as a welded differential, this connects the wheels so they go at the
same speed. This made turning a little more difficult. Most full-sized trucks have this type of differential. 
 Limited-slip differential – Found in sports cars, the limited-slip differential acts like an open differential
by default. Once a wheel loses traction, then it shifts to act as a locking differential so there is more
traction and control on the road.  
 Torque-vectoring differential – With additional gear trains, the torque-vectoring differential can fine-
tune the amount of torque delivered to each wheel.
Construction of a differential
 As shown in the above image, there are various parts in this differential unit. This is
an open differential. A pinion gear is mounted on the pinion shaft. Actually, this
pinion shaft is a propeller shaft. This pinion gear rotates the big ring gear. A Carrier
unit mounted on the ring gear. It consists of two bevel pinions (planet pinions) and
two bevels (sun) gears. The sun bevel gears are connected with the half shaft of the
rear axle. A differential housing covers this whole assembly. And axle housing
covers the half shaft.
Other uses of a Differential
The differential gear helps during turning and cornering at continues speed. It’s
also having other uses. Like,
1. It transfers power at 90° with independent rpm when required.
2. Reduces the pinions rpm at the ring gear. As a result, reduced rpm and higher
torque at wheel.
